No, there is no direct bus from Southampton Airport (SOU) to Romsey. However, there are services departing from Southampton Airport (SOU) station and arriving at Romsey station via Bus Station station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h.
Southampton Airport (SOU) to Romsey bus services, operated by Bluestar, depart from Barton Peveril College station.
Southampton Airport (SOU) to Romsey bus services, operated by Bluestar, arrive at Bus Station.
The distance between Southampton Airport (SOU) and Romsey is 10.6 km. The road distance is 14 km.
Bluestar operates a bus from Barton Peveril College to Bus Station hourly. Tickets cost £7 and the journey takes 29 min.
